Why you need it ?
Piston rings seal the combustion chamber, control oil on the cylinder wall, and transfer heat from the piston to the cylinder. Fresh rings prevent blow-by, improve fuel economy, and protect the catalyst by keeping oil out of the exhaust.
How it works ?️
The set includes a top compression ring, a second scraper ring, and a multi-piece oil control assembly. Under firing pressure, the top ring expands to seal; the second ring wipes gases downward; the oil ring meters and returns oil via drain slots. Modern coatings resist scuffing and high heat cycles.
When worn or broken ⚠️
Expect hard starts, low compression, blue smoke, high oil use, fouled plugs, misfires, poor acceleration, and rising crankcase pressure. Prolonged use can score cylinders and damage the catalytic converter.
Pro install tips ?
Hone to a 45° crosshatch, measure end gap, set ring orientations staggered, lubricate lightly, and follow torque specs. Perform a careful break-in for perfect seating.
